The UK’s leading smoky cheese has won its third award in two years. Applewood has taken out the silver award for the Smoked Cheese class at this year’s Virtual Cheese Awards. This success follows hot on the heels of Applewood winning Bronze in the Smoky Flavour Cheese category at the ICDA and Bronze in the Blended – Smoked Category of the British Cheese Awards.
Senior brand manager, Ffion Davies, said: “The Applewood team are over the moon to win this latest accolade from the prestigious Virtual Cheese Awards. We have been the UK's number one smoky cheese for many years now and it is great to still be winning awards and getting recognition for this fantastic cheese, which is the perfect blend of farmhouse cheddar, a delicate smoky flavour and a lovely smooth texture, all finished with a dusting of paprika.”
Applewood was the first branded cheese to introduce a plant-based version when it launched Applewood Vegan back in 2019, which has gone on to win 12 awards and is available in Block, Grated, Slices and new Minis snacking format.
